TV's Vernon and Tess witness Wanderers win

Last updated : 13 September 2003 By Mark Heys
Celebrity Bolton Wanderers supporter Vernon Kay and his new wife Tess Daly where amongst the 26,000 plus crowd who witnessed Bolton's 2-0 win over Middlesbrough on Saturday.

The TV presenters who wed each other in a ceremony in Horwich near Bolton on Friday where joined by friends and family to see the Wanderers notch up their first win of the new season.

Bolton born Vernon, a lifelong Wanderers fan was signing autographs for fellow fans whilst Stockport born Tess, now herself a fully fledged Wanderer no doubt, where pictured in the crowd enjoying the match before jetting off on their honeymoon.

Former Wanderers skipper Gudni Bergsson, a legend in his own right for his acheivements at Bolton between 1995 and 2003 was on hand to do the clubs half time Golden Gamble draw, whilst next years Academy intake and new signing Ibrahim Ba where paraded to the crowd.

Fellow new boy Glen Little missed the match through injury
